Visbrain
Visbrain is an open-source python 3 package dedicated to brain signals visualization. It is based on top of VisPy and PyQt and is distributed under the 3-Clause BSD license. We also provide an on line documentation, examples and datasets and can also be downloaded from PyPi.

Installation
Dependencies
Visbrain requires :
NumPy >= 1.13
SciPy
VisPy >= 0.5.0
Matplotlib >= 1.5.5
PyQt5
Pillow
User installation
Install Visbrain :
pip install visbrain
We also strongly recommend to install pandas and pyopengl :
pip install pandas PyOpenGL PyOpenGL_accelerate
Modules
Brain : visualize EEG/MEG/Intracranial data, connectivity in a standard MNI 3D brain (see Brain examples).
Sleep : visualize and analyze polysomnographic sleep data (see Sleep examples).
Signal : data-mining module for time-series inspection (see Signal examples).
Topo : display topographical maps (see Topo examples).
Figure : figure-layout for high-quality publication-like figures (see Figure examples).
Colorbar : colorbar editor (see Colorbar examples).
